Was reprogramming something on my werk truck and computer shut off midway (slipped off my lap,musta hit a button in process).
Now i'm getting nothing from it.
Tried pcm recovery several times but it just keeps asking me for the security key.
I was doing a full flash at the time,and i'm afraid I scrambled the bootloader if my understanding is correct.
I do not have the skill (or equipment) to desolder the chip amd try messing with it in burner (if it would even fit any of my adaptors).
Any suggestions?

if you have a bench top use antus flash tool to sniff out the seed and key or try FFFF. I have also had one bricked i used a bench harness disconnected from power touched the power and ground feed wires to drain any capacitors and was able to recover.
